<p>If you are going to Toronto, make sure you check out the Templar Hotel, a new boutique hotel that has opened in the entertainment district. Beyond the narrow entrance, visitors find glowing modern art installations and specially-designed Poliform furnishings giving the lobby an air of cool, custom-built luxury. This modern eight-story building was custom built by local designer Del Terrelonge, and has been no less than 10 years in the making. The 27 rooms have a toned down retro style, bespoke furnishings, wooden floors and marble; amenities include linen sheets, Egyptian cotton duvet covers and silk-stuffed pillows, in-room iPads, and toiletries by boutique brands like Red Flower and Malin+ Goetz.</p>
<p>Onsite facilities include the Monk Restaurant and a Japanese-style spa, complete with a deep, sand-blasted pool, through which you can gaze down into the Templar’s design-inspired bar.</p>
